Barrier blocks in the electronics industry are specialized terminal blocks designed to provide electrical separation between adjacent circuits. They feature insulating barriers or walls between each connection point, preventing unintentional contact or short circuits. Barrier blocks are commonly used in applications where maintaining electrical isolation is crucial, such as in power distribution panels and industrial control systems.
